Trivia about the song Mission impossible by Golden Earring

On which albums was the song “Mission impossible” released by Golden Earring?
Golden Earring released the song on the albums “N.E.W.S.” in 1984 and “Something Heavy Going Down” in 1984.
Who composed the song “Mission impossible” by Golden Earring?
The song “Mission impossible” by Golden Earring was composed by Barry Hay and George Kooymans.
